Evaluation of pesticide computability against stem borer, leaf folder and sheath blight of rice in irrigated ecosystem


Author(s): SKS Rajpoot, V Prasad, Saurabh Dixit, DK Verma, SP Giri, RA Singh and T Kumar

Abstract: Experiments were conducted to evaluate the compatibility of insecticide with fungicide against major insect pest (stem borer, leaf folder) and disease (sheath blight) of rice during ws 2017 and 2018. Insect pests and disease infestations are the primary constraints in rice (Oryza sativa. L) Production. The rice stem borer, leaf folder and sheath blight causing major loss of production. The experiment consisted of nine treatments combination viz.T1-Spinetoram 6% + methoxyfenozide 30% @ 0.75 g/l., T2- DPX-RAB 55 @ 0.48 g/l., T3- Contaf Plus 2.0 g/letter,4- Mantis 75@ 0.6 g/l., T5- Spinetoram 6% + methoxyfenozide 30%+Contaf (Spinetoram 6% + methoxyfenozide 30%+ Hexaconazole) @ 0.75+2.0 g/l,T6- Spinetoram 6% + methoxyfenozide 30%+ Mantis (Spinetoram 6% + methoxyfenozide 30%+ Tricyclazole)@ 0.75+0.6 g/l., T7- DPX-RAB 55+Contaf (Triflumezopyrim +Hexaconazole)@ 0.48+2.0 g/l.,T8- DPX-RAB 55+Mantis (Triflumezopyrim + Tricyclazole)@ 0.48+0.6 g/l. andT9- Untreated control. During both the years incidence of yellow stem borer and leaf folder at vegetative stage was below threshold level but at reproductive stage of crop growth incidence of yellow stem borer, leaf folder and sheath blight were observed significantly higher, due to congenial environment for insect pest and disease development and growth. Among treatments combination DPX-RAB 55+Contaf (Triflumezopyrim +Hexaconazole) was found most effective against yellow stem borerof rice resulted with lower dead heart% 4.2 (30 DAT), 4.7 (50 DAT) and white ear%. 0.8%. DPX-RAB 55+Contaf (Triflumezopyrim +Hexaconazole) was also found effective to control incidence of leaf folder% 1.1 (30 DAT), 0.5 (50 DAT) and sheath blight 18.2%. Maximum grain yield was also recorded with the treatment of DPX-RAB 55+Contaf Triflumezopyrim +Hexaconazole – 0.48+2.0 g/letter (3450 kg/ha) followed by DPX RAB 55+ Mantis.
